Sustainability Journey
This hotel has received the Green Star award for its high degree of sustainability and environmental awareness. It utilizes ingredients from its own production, including a vegetable garden, apiary, and herd of cattle, and sources water from its own mineral water well for brewing and drinking.

Sustainability Journey
This hotel follows a comprehensive ecological philosophy with natural furnishings and organic cuisine sourced mainly from Demeter and Bioland-certified farms. It uses water from a local spring, produces its own electricity and heating with a block-type thermal power station, and has been awarded the Bavarian Environmental Seal in Gold.

Sustainability Journey
This hotel is a pioneer in sustainable tourism in the Alps, being climate-positive since 2017 by offsetting more CO2 than it emits through initiatives like afforestation in Panama and investing in humus certificates. It generates 60% of its energy needs through solar and biomass, uses natural cleaning products, and sources a large majority of its food regionally.

Sustainability Journey
This hotel has received multiple sustainability awards, including the 'Royal Accommodation Award for Sustainable Tourism' and the Gold of the Bavarian Environmental Seal. It won the 'Green Spa Award' and is a member of Umweltpakt Bayern, consistently implementing eco-friendly measures since 1998. The hotel offers a 100% organic and vegan kitchen and provides an electric car charging station.

Sustainability Journey
Hotel Das Rübezahl's commitment to sustainability is deeply ingrained in their philosophy, having been an integral part of their operations since its inception in 1959. For over three generations, the Thurm family has championed sustainability practices such as economical energy usage, regional produce sourcing, and resource-saving construction, among others. Key to these efforts is the use of advanced technologies such as photovoltaics and a state-of-the-art combined heat and power plant that has been meeting 90% of their electricity needs since 2021. Additionally, the hotel is equipped with energy-saving devices, primarily employing LED lamps with timers and motion detectors. Innovative measures like heat recovery from their cold stores to heat their pool and whirlpool further reduce energy usage.

The hotel not only promotes climate-friendly holidays, allowing guests to offset their carbon footprint with sustainable reforestation projects, but it also takes significant steps towards resource conservation. By employing water-saving devices and utilizing rainwater for tasks like flushing toilets and watering flowers, the hotel reduces conventional water consumption by up to 15% annually. Additionally, a commitment to local sourcing reduces transport-related emissions, and their Beauty Alm emphasizes the power of nature through the use of pure and natural cosmetics. Mobility solutions, including e-car charging stations, rental bicycles and e-bikes, and free local public transport for hotel guests, contribute to a low-impact travel experience. Furthermore, a robust commitment to biodiversity is evident in their natural compensation areas tended by six bee colonies, regular mountain tours educating guests about local flora, and dedicated spaces for threatened species.

Sustainability Journey
This hotel holds the GreenSign Hotel Zertifizierung Level 5 and the Umwelt + Klimapakt Bayern in Gold, demonstrating a strong commitment to sustainability. It is also a member of Green Pearls, focusing on environmental protection. The hotel utilizes environmentally friendly building materials, has its own ecosystem with a natural swimming pond, monitors energy consumption weekly for efficiency, and uses combined heat and power plants for CO2-neutral heating. They avoid single-use products and source raw materials regionally.

Sustainability Journey
As the first hotel in Germany to receive the EU Ecolabel, this hotel demonstrates a comprehensive commitment to sustainability. Ecological aspects were central to its construction, incorporating energy efficiency measures and blending into the natural landscape. The hotel emphasizes regional sourcing for its cuisine and has a 'Green Choice' option for guests to support local mountain rescue.

Sustainability Journey
Hotel Luise is recognized as Germany's first climate-positive hotel and has been awarded the EU Eco Label. It implements extensive sustainability measures including a Cradle-to-Cradle principle for materials, solar panels, water saving showers, waste reduction, and promoting biodiversity with a large garden area. They also offer a fresh, organic, fairtrade, and local breakfast buffet.

Sustainability Journey
This hotel emphasizes tradition, regionality, and nature connection. They use exclusively regional and predominantly organic products in their bio-certified restaurant, with herbs from their garden and honey from their own bees. The hotel is heated by two combined heat and power plants and uses certified green electricity for their electric car charging station. Rooms are built with ecological materials and have mains isolation switches.

Sustainability Journey
At the WalhallaHotel Regensburg Hoeferer, sustainability is not just an afterthought, but an integral part of their operations. The hotel is proud to be certified to GSTC-Recognized Standards and carries the Ecolabel or Eco Flower (EU) and PEFC certifications. It demonstrates a solid commitment to green practices, boasting a variety of eco-friendly services and facilities. Utilizing solar, hydro, geothermal, and biomass energy, the hotel powerfully integrates renewable resources to energize its premises. The building's architectural design is crafted to maximize the benefits of airflow and natural sunlight, reducing reliance on air-conditioning, artificial lighting, and heating. Notably, the facility features triple-glazed windows, providing superb insulation to regulate both heat and cold.

Besides energy conservation, the hotel implements a range of sustainable practices. Rainwater is diligently harvested and reused, and the use of non-toxic cleaning agents ensures an environment that is both safe and healthy. Committed to serving fresh, organic food at the restaurant, a considerable portion is procured from local suppliers, simultaneously bolstering local economies and reducing transportation-induced carbon emissions. LED lighting is used throughout the premises, reducing energy consumption further. A dedicated environmental manager oversees these practices, and all employees receive training to follow environmental policies. For guests keen on reducing their carbon footprint, the hotel offers bicycles for local exploration and electric car charging stations. Waste management at the hotel is also carefully considered, with waste separated into at least three categories, organic waste composted, and a policy in place to avoid disposable cups, glasses, plates, and cutlery. These initiatives, coupled with the provision of eco-labeled or non-chlorine bleached toilet paper, and toilets that flush up to 6 litres per flush, demonstrate the hotel's comprehensive approach to sustainability. The establishment further strengthens its green credentials by being a zero-energy building, with an automatic system that turns off the light and electrical appliances when guests leave their room. To ensure ongoing efficiency, an energy audit is carried out at least once every five years.

Sustainability Journey
ARBERLAND Tagungshaus takes pride in its commitment to sustainability and eco-friendly practices. Certified by TripAdvisor GreenLeaders, Klima Umwelt Pakt Bayern, and as a Fairtrade Partner, the hotel's environment-friendly ethos extends across its operations. Energy is derived from renewable biomass, ensuring reduced carbon footprint. The use of non-toxic cleaning products, LED lighting, and the appointment of an environmental manager reinforce their dedication to green principles.

An essential aspect of the hotel's eco-friendly approach involves measures aimed at resource management and conservation. Toilets with reduced flush volume and signs encouraging guests to reuse towels are implemented for water conservation. Composting of organic waste and separation of waste into at least three categories highlight their efficient waste management system. The commitment to local and organic food sourcing for their restaurant, where a vegetarian menu is also provided, adds a gastronomic dimension to their sustainability practices. The hotel also provides bicycles for guests, promoting eco-friendly mobility. Added to all this, the establishment conducts an energy audit every five years, reinforcing its commitment to efficient energy use. A final noteworthy feature is their effort to reduce plastic usage in rooms, and their use of refillable hotel supplies and digital guest maps.
